本文目录导读:
服务器端口配置是确保网络应用正常运行的关键环节,合理配置服务器端口可以有效提高系统性能,降低安全风险,本文将从服务器端口配置方法与技巧两个方面进行深入解析,帮助您更好地掌握服务器端口配置的精髓。
图片来源于网络,如有侵权联系删除
服务器端口配置方法
1、了解端口类型
服务器端口分为以下几种类型:
(1)TCP端口:用于传输控制协议,保证数据传输的可靠性。
(2)UDP端口:用于用户数据报协议,数据传输速度较快,但可靠性较低。
(3)端口号:端口号是服务器端口的唯一标识,范围在0-65535之间。
2、确定端口用途
在配置服务器端口之前,首先要明确端口的用途,以下是一些常见的端口用途:
(1)HTTP端口:80(默认)、8080等,用于Web服务器。
(2)HTTPS端口:443(默认),用于加密的Web服务器。
(3)SSH端口:22(默认),用于远程登录。
(4)FTP端口:21(默认),用于文件传输。
图片来源于网络,如有侵权联系删除
3、配置端口
根据端口用途,在服务器上进行以下配置:
(1)修改服务配置文件:对于基于Linux的服务,通常需要修改服务配置文件来设置端口,对于Apache服务器,需要修改httpd.conf文件;对于Nginx服务器,需要修改nginx.conf文件。
(2)重启服务:修改配置文件后,需要重启服务以使配置生效。
(3)设置防火墙规则:为确保安全,需要在防火墙上允许对应端口的访问。
4、监控端口状态
配置完成后,需要定期监控端口状态,以确保服务器正常运行,可以使用以下工具进行端口监控:
(1)netstat:查看系统端口状态。
(2)lsof:查看占用端口的进程。
(3)nmap:扫描目标主机端口。
服务器端口配置技巧
1、使用高端口
图片来源于网络,如有侵权联系删除
为了避免端口冲突,建议使用高端口(大于1024)进行服务器配置。
2、避免端口冲突
在配置服务器端口时,要确保端口不与其他服务或应用程序冲突。
3、优化端口分配
对于常用的端口,可以将其分配给性能较好的服务器,以提高整体性能。
4、设置端口重定向
在需要的情况下,可以将外部端口重定向到内部端口,以实现安全访问。
5、使用SSL/TLS加密
对于涉及敏感信息传输的端口,建议使用SSL/TLS加密,以确保数据安全。
标签: #服务器端口配置
评论列表